What bicycles are worth

What lifts the price

  • Recent chain, brake pads and tyres
  • Frame free of cracks, dents and rust

What pulls it down

  • Rust on the chain and drivetrain
  • Supermarket bikes with unserviceable parts

Working out what yours is worth

  • Spin both wheels and watch for side-to-side movement
  • Confirm the frame size and photograph any rust

Getting it ready

  • Check both brakes, run through every gear, and spin both wheels to check they run true.
  • Clean the drivetrain, pump the tyres, and check for rust at the chainstays and under the bottom bracket.

Photograph

  • The whole bike side on, drive side, against a plain wall
  • The drivetrain and gears close up

Put in the description

  • Frame size, and the rider height range it suits
  • Bike type, frame material and wheel size

Type, frame size and brand: “Carrera Hybrid Bike, Medium 19in Frame, 21 Speed”. Frame size is the primary filter. Say what type it is — hybrid, road, mountain, town — because those are separate searches with different buyers.

Is there any rust?

Look at the chainstays, under the bottom bracket and inside the seat tube. Surface rust is cosmetic; structural rust is not, and buyers should be told which it is.
